Understanding HDB to Condo ABSD Rules

Navigating the intricate world of property transactions in Singapore can be a daunting task, especially when dealing the Additional Buyer's Stamp Duty (ABSD). This duty applies to individuals who acquire second or subsequent properties, including moving from a Housing and Development Board (HDB) flat to a condominium.

Understanding the ABSD rules is vital to avoid unexpected costs and ensure a smooth property acquisition. The rate of ABSD varies based on factors such as the buyer's nationality and the number of properties they already have.

For instance, Singaporean citizens purchasing their first HDB flat are free from ABSD. However, if they subsequently acquire a condominium, they will be subject to a significant ABSD rate.

Furthermore, the ABSD rate can fluctuate over time, so it is crucial to stay updated on the latest rules and regulations. Consult with a qualified real estate professional to gain a in-depth understanding of HDB to condo ABSD rules and determine informed decisions about your property acquisition.

Trading Up: From HDB Flat to Condo - A Step-by-Step Timeline

Making the transition from an HDB flat to a condo is a major milestone for many Singaporeans. It's a involved process that requires careful thought.

Here's a general step-by-step timeline to guide you through this journey:

  • Firstly, you'll need to evaluate your financial position. This includes examining your savings, income, and existing debts.
  • Next, start investigating the condo market. Think about your preferred location, size, amenities, and budget.

  • Alongside this, get pre-approved for a mortgage from a bank or financial institution. This will give you a clearer idea of how much you can finance.
